  The Pirates
of Penzance
Domestic Release Date Feb 18, 1983
Production Budget  
Opening Weekend Theaters 91
Maximum Theaters 91
Theatrical Engagements 195
Domestic Opening Weekend $255,496
Domestic Box Office $694,497
Inflation Adjusted
Domestic Box Office
$2,376,721
International Box Office
Worldwide Box Office $694,497

Note: A theatrical engagement is defined as the movie playing in a single theater for one week. So, for example, a film that plays in 3,000 theaters in its first week and 2,000 theaters in its second week will have had 5,000 theatrical engagements.
